An update about George in 11JJ, our BCHS Man of Steel.

George has been competing in the 3 day Obstacle Course Racing (OCR) World Championships event.

After day one George was placed third in the UK, and fortieth in the world. The days race was a 3km course with 80 obstacles, all of which George completed on his first attempt.

Day two was even more gruelling; a 15km race over mud and 100 obstacles to complete. George was able to completed 97 obstacles on his first attempt. He was placed ninth in the UK and twenty-sixth in the world.

Day three was the team event, which offered a chance to work together and have some fun. With wreck backs, pulls and carries, George excelled on the technical section. It was noted that George’s performance this year showed huge improvement since last year in terms of technical ability, strength but also attitude and mental resilience.

The future is certainly looking bright for George in this sport and as ever, we are so proud of George’s determination and commitment to succeed.
